I kinda miss him, he was tough all around and he was way more versatile then expected when we signed him, could handle multiple tasks. Hadnt seen him much before due to injury issues in Miami last year. But he was being a bonafide off bench point forward with some very decent skill for us, and hustling on every play. Still just a depth guy, but he did his thing with a limited roster, very team first guy that did most of the intagible things you take for granted. Screens, faciliates effortlessly, defends perimeter, bangs down low with bigs, decent spot up etc. All around player.


Liked his attitude too. Usually these journeyman are lukewarm mercenaries, but for us Johnson was the most enegetic and most hyped up at all times for us, this is a guy passing through playing with a broken roster of kids, and he was really into it, could see him spreading the enthusiasm to the youngsters each game. Proper competitve glue guy.



It also goes without saying he is tough as nails, Jeff Green is more offensively talented player, but if there something left in the tank, I would guess that JJ will be a better all around team player and hard nosed enforcer when someone goes after your dainty super stars.
